Transaction 8cc23fe64c545ffbc61ffdf225d2161d0ef56f6f51b6301ac83dabf2efa9c41e

1 Input
2 Outputs
  • 8cc23fe64c545ffbc61ffdf225d2161d0ef56f6f51b6301ac83dabf2efa9c41e:0
  • value  2043300
    address  328X1uLZruqYHBn4WuratRs5c2nLhqBnx2
  • 8cc23fe64c545ffbc61ffdf225d2161d0ef56f6f51b6301ac83dabf2efa9c41e:1
  • value  2667783
    address  16FWnjkmBdZMm7LHTBBSDobtvbepzWCgDV